Lady Gaga has left fans devastated and in tears after cancelling her Las Vegas show with just 20 minutes notice.

The Poker Face singer took to Instagram and Twitter to share a snap of herself hooked up to a breathalyser and an IV, revealing: “I’m so devastated I can’t perform tonight for so many people who travelled to come to see me.”

She added: “I have a sinus infection and bronchitis and feel very sick and sad I never want to let you down.

“I’m just too weak and ill to perform tonight. I love you little monsters I’ll make it up to you. I promise.”

Fans quickly took to social media to share their disappointment with many wondering why it took Gaga so long to make the decision.

“I came to Vegas for the 11/6 Enigma show, which was cancelled as we were in the GA line to enter the venue, and I am still devastated over it,” confided one fan who added that “everyone around me started crying” when it was cancelled. According to the Sun.co.uk.

“I got the tickets in Aug. ’18 and have been looking forward to tonight, especially after a pretty difficult year,” she added.

“I started crying. The atmosphere went from 100 to 0 in 30 seconds, & it just got worse as reality started hitting more people = more sobbing. Crowd effect was in play.”

Another fan revealed that they “flew 7000 miles to see her here after she cancelled our last 3 Joanne tour shows in the UK, we’re devastated”.

It is unclear whether Gaga will be well enough to perform on Friday 8 November, the next date on her schedule.

Gaga is on a two-year residency in Vegas, It is not the first time the singer has cancelled tour dates. however, in 2018 she axed 10 shows in the UK and Europe admitting she must “put me and my well-being first”.
